Company Profile: Precision Castparts Corp. (PCC) is a leading worldwide, diversified manufacturer of complex metal components and products. It serves the aerospace, power, and general industrial markets. PCC is the market leader in manufacturing large, complex structural investment castings, airfoil castings, and forged components used in jet aircraft engines and industrial gas turbines. The Company is also a leading producer of highly engineered, critical fasteners for aerospace and other general industrial markets, manufactures extruded seamless pipe, fittings, forgings, and clad products for power generation and oil & gas applications, and supplies metal alloys and other materials to the casting and forging industries. PCC is a high-quality business with dominant positions in most segments of the markets in which it serves. Headquartered in Portland, Oregon, this over 10-billion-dollar company employs more than 29,500 people worldwide. PCC has over 160 plants and has a presence in twenty-six states in the US and in over a dozen countries. PCC is relentless in its dedication to being a high-quality, low-cost and on-time producer, delivering the highest value to its customers and shareholders while continually pursuing strategic, profitable growth. Effective early February 2016, Berkshire Hathaway, led by chairman and CEO Warren E. Buffet, acquired Precision Castparts Corp.

Business Profile:AVK Industrial Products, a Precision Castparts Company, manufactures superior mechanical inserts, studs, compression limiters, installation tools and military standard bolts. AVK produces blind installed threaded fasteners for transportation and general industrial markets worldwide. We use state of the art high-speed cold forming equipment to produce blind installed threaded inserts and studs. We feature product lines of both unified (INCH) and metric fasteners along with numerous special designs that meet customer application requirements. All aspects of our business are controlled and certified to the exacting requirements of ISO 9001:2015, IATF 16949:2016 and ISO 14001:2015 international standards. Housed in an 80,000 square-foot facility in the Valencia Industrial Center, AVK has been manufacturing high quality products for over 25 years.

This position requires use of information or access to production processes subject to national security controls under U.S. export control laws and regulations (including, but not limited to the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) and the Export Administration Regulations (EAR)). To be qualified to work in this facility, a successful applicant must be a U.S. Person, as defined in those regulations, and able to supply evidence of that qualification prior to starting work or be authorized to receive controlled information under a specific license or permission from the relevant government agency. The U.S. export control regulations define a U.S. person as a U.S. Citizen, U.S. National, U.S. Permanent Resident (i.e. 'Green Card Holder'), and certain categories of Asylees and Refugees.
